Six recent Tollywood releases have drawn audiences back to theaters, marking a significant turnaround for the industry.
Tollywood has faced a steep decline in theater attendance over the past few years, with many audiences turning to digital platforms for entertainment. Recent reports indicate that six blockbuster releases have begun to reverse this trend, drawing sizable crowds back to cinemas across the country.
The surge in footfall is attributed to a combination of strong storytelling, high production values, and effective marketing strategies that have resonated with viewers. As a result, box‑office collections for these films have surpassed expectations, signaling a renewed confidence in the theatrical experience.
Industry analysts view the revival as a positive sign for the regional film sector, suggesting that a robust slate of quality productions can sustain audience interest. Stakeholders are optimistic that this momentum will encourage further investment in Tollywood’s big‑screen ventures.
While the long‑term impact remains to be seen, the current uptick demonstrates that Tollywood is reclaiming its position as a major player in India’s cinematic landscape.
